Hamas Fires Rockets from Lebanon Towards Israeli Targets

In a concerning escalation of regional tensions, the militant group Hamas fired rockets from Lebanese territory towards Israeli targets. This act, which took place along the northern border of Israel, has the potential to ignite further conflict in the already volatile Middle East.

The incident marks a significant departure from the usual locations of rocket attacks associated with Hamas, which is primarily based in the Gaza Strip. Lebanon’s involvement in this attack raises questions about the broader dynamics in the region and the extent of influence that various parties hold over the actions of militant groups.

Hamas, designated as a terrorist organization by several countries, including Israel, the United States, and the European Union, has been a key actor in the Israeli-Palestinian conflict. The group’s activities, including rocket attacks, are a recurring source of concern for regional stability.
